麻豆精选 at Stark will host a Campus Preview for high school juniors, seniors and their parents on Saturday, Nov. 4. Campus tours will be held from 8 to 8:30 a.m. and depart from the lobby at Main Hall, 6000 Frank Ave. NW. The program will take place from 9 a.m. to 12:30 p.m. in the new Science & Nursing Building, Room 101. Campus Preview will introduce prospective students to 麻豆精选Stark鈥檚 academic programs, departments and services in an informal atmosphere to allow for questions and conversation. 麻豆精选 has received a $3.1 million gift for a College of Business Administration scholarship endowment from the estate of 麻豆精选alumnus Joseph Stevens. The Stevens Family Scholarship for the College of Business Administration was established by Joseph and Frances Stevens. Associate Professor Michele Ewing earned the Public Relations Student Society of America鈥檚 (PRSSA) highest honor for Chapter advisor at the organization鈥檚 national conference earlier this month. Fifteen members of PRSSA Kent, along with Ewing, who has served as Kent State鈥檚 Chapter advisor for 14 years, traveled to Boston for the conference, where Ewing received the Teahan Faculty Advisor Award for outstanding service, guidance and contribution to the chapter. Denise A. Seachrist, 麻豆精选 at Stark, presented 鈥淎uctioning Off History: Twenty Years Following the Sad Demise of the Snow Hill Cloister鈥 at the Communal Studies Association Annual Conference in Zoar, Ohio, on Oct. 6, 2017. Summary: The Snow Hill Cloister (Nunnery) was established in 1829 in Franklin County, Pennsylvania, on the farm of Andreas Schneeberger and was considered an offshoot of the more well-known Ephrata Cloister, a communal settlement of German immigrants established in 1732 by Conrad Beissel in Lancaster County, Pennsylvania.
